Market Overview:
The global automobile front lighting system market is expected to grow at a CAGR of 5.5% during the forecast period from 2018 to 2030. The market growth can be attributed to the increasing demand for automobiles, especially in developing countries such as China and India. Additionally, the increasing focus on vehicle safety is also driving the demand for front lighting systems globally. The global automobile front lighting system market can be segmented by type, application and region. By type, the market can be divided into low beam, high beam and others. Low beam systems are more common than high beam systems and are used in most vehicles across all regions globally. By application, cars accounted for the majority of sales in 2017 and this trend is expected to continue during the forecast period as well. SUV’s are becoming increasingly popular across all regions due to their growing popularity among consumers looking for features such as increased space and comfort levels along with better performance characteristics compared to cars segments .Pickup trucks are also witnessing rising demand in developed markets such as North America and Europe due their usage by commercial fleets operators .By region, North America was estimated to account for around one-third of total sales revenue generated by automotive front lighting system manufacturers worldwide in 2017 followed closely by Europe .
Product Definition:
The automobile front lighting system is a system that consists of headlights, fog lights, and other lights that are used to light the road in front of the vehicle. These lights help the driver see what is in front of them while driving, which can help to prevent accidents.
